    Least of our worries, English teams all have the same closure time anyway. It's the moneybags foreign teams that are the issue.
    FSG stood firm this time against enormous pressure from Barca and the media - will they be able to do that every time? Will other clubs be able to do it?
    We'll be left with three weeks of players all throwing girly tantrums because they want to make their "dream move" come true with scant regard for the effect it has on their current club.
    Apart from other leagues coming into line, the only other way it would work is if the rules were changed and both ins and outs finished together. I haven't even thought that through to see if it's practical.

    May have been the foreign clubs that unsettled you this time, but for 90% of the league its from other english clubs. It's unfair on clubs to have their players unsettled whilst the season starts.

    At least with this new end of the window, their will be less teams who will have their players unsettled.

    I know this still puts british clubs at a disadvantage but realistically how many foreign clubs buy players from the PL when its not the club deliberately releasing their player.

    The only ones off the top of my head have been Ronaldo, Fabregas, Coutinho, Suarez, Vieira, Modric, Bale, Henry, De Gea.

    Hopefully Europe will fall in line with us but this is better than doing nothing
